American investors pile more money into India as tensions with China keep
rising
18 Jul, 2020
India has attracted over $40 billion in foreign direct investment (FDI) from
the US, after the latest funding spree from major tech giants, such as
Google and Facebook, according to a US-based business advocacy group.
American companies have boosted investment in India despite the coronavirus
pandemic, the president of the US-India Strategic and Partnership Forum (
USISPF), Mukesh Aghi, has said. According to his data, in recent weeks alone
, the nation secured over $20 billion in funds, including those from Silicon
Valley behemoths as well as investors from the Middle East, among other
regions.
“Year to date investment from the US, including the recent ones, is over $
40 billion,” the head of the USISPF, which keeps track of the major US FDIs
in India, said, as cited by media. “Investors’ confidence in India is
high. India still remains a very promising market for the global investors.”
Earlier this week, Google announced that it will pile $4.5 billion into
India’s Jio Platforms, part of the nation’s most highly-valued company,
controlled by Asia's richest man, Mukesh Ambani. Facebook invested $5.7
billion for a 9.99 percent stake in the company in April. In total,
investors have bought over $20 billion-worth of shares in Jio Platforms.
The tech giant’s investment to the South Asian country could be a signal
that trust in China is falling, while “India becomes a big competitor,”
White House Economic Advisor, Larry Kudlow, said. However, it is fair to
note the US investments in the Chinese economy have also been on the rise.
According to China’s Ministry of Commerce, FDI from the US to China rose
six percent in the first half of 2020, compared to the same period last year
.
The rising interest of American tech giants in India comes as tensions
continue to rise between Washington and Beijing. At the same time, the
recent deadly clash at their disputed border in the Himalayas soured India-
China relations, resulting in New Delhi’s ban of dozens of Chinese apps,
its tightening of controls on imports from the country and a possible ban on
Huawei from its 5G networks.
However, India is believed to have long been trying to cash in on the trade
tensions between the world’s two biggest economies. Earlier reports
signaled that New Delhi was busy creating a framework that will attract
